Structural underpinning services involve reinforcing and stabilizing the foundation of a property to prevent or correct issues caused by shifting, settling, or deterioration. This process typically includes installing supports such as piers, piles, or braces beneath the foundation to lift and stabilize the structure. The goal is to restore the integrity of the building’s base, ensuring it remains level and secure over time. By addressing foundational concerns early, homeowners can protect their property from further damage and maintain its safety and value.
These services are often sought when properties experience signs of foundation problems, such as uneven floors, cracked walls, sticking doors or windows, or noticeable settling. Structural underpinning helps solve these issues by providing a stable base that prevents further movement. It can also correct existing damage caused by soil movement, moisture changes, or poor initial construction. Local contractors use specialized equipment and techniques to carefully assess each property’s needs and implement solutions that restore stability and peace of mind.
Properties that typically require underpinning include older homes with shifting foundations, homes built on expansive clay soils, or structures that have experienced water damage or nearby construction activity. Commercial buildings, townhomes, and even some multi-family residences may also benefit from underpinning if their foundations show signs of distress. This service is essential for properties where ongoing settlement threatens structural safety or where previous foundation work has failed to provide lasting support.

The overview below groups typical Structural Underpinning proj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Louisville, KY.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or underpinning work in Louisville often range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, covering localized lifting or stabilization. Larger or more complex repairs can exceed this range, depending on the scope.
Moderate Projects - Projects involving several piers or partial foundation stabilization usually cost between $1,000 and $3,500. These are common for homes experiencing moderate settling or shifting, handled by local contractors within this budget.
Full Foundation Underpinning - Complete underpinning of an entire foundation can range from $5,000 to $15,000 or more, especially for larger properties. Such projects are less frequent but necessary for significant structural issues requiring extensive work.
Larger, Complex Jobs - Extensive underpinning involving multiple structures or major foundation replacements can reach $20,000 or higher. These projects are less common and typically involve detailed planning and specialized techniques by experienced service providers.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is structural underpinning? Structural underpinning involves strengthening or stabilizing a building's foundation to address issues like settling, uneven floors, or structural movement.
How do local contractors perform underpinning work? They typically assess the foundation, then use techniques such as piering or slab jacking to restore stability and support the structure.
What signs indicate a need for underpinning services? Common signs include cracks in walls or floors, doors or windows that won't stay closed, and noticeable unevenness in the building's structure.
Are underpinning methods suitable for different types of foundations? Yes, experienced service providers can adapt underpinning techniques to various foundation types, including concrete slabs, basements, and crawl spaces.
